We stayed here initially for one night on our way home after collecting Motorhome from the other end of the country but ended up extending to three nights.
The site was easy to find, great location cLose to Axminster for cheap fuel etc and the coastal towns/villages of Bridnorth, Charmouth, Lyme Regis etc
We were late arriving but that was no problem for the office team, and we easily found our pitch etc as they had left clear instructions adjacent to the office for us.
The pitches were really spacious, plenty of facilities including dog paddock and Childrens park, a nice countryside feel to the site. There is a new toilet/shower block with good sized free showers, family rooms and a baby changing room with shower. A Motorhome service point, laundry and washing up room where sinks were plentiful.
Some road noise in the distance but not noticeable to bother us.
All the staff were friendly and helpful.
There is also a winter storage compound on site.
We wish we lived closer so we could visit regularly!

Excellent site with two facillity blocks, both very nice and clean.
Staff friendly and helpful.
Our pitch, 8, was huge and close to water and grey water disposal. Plenty of trees and wild flowers, nature is encouraged all over the site, birds and rabbits in abundance.
A short drive from the site to Charmouth for fossil hunting or Lyme Regis with its harbour. Axminster is nearby too. The site is just off the A35 giving good access to west Dorset and east Devon.
Breakfasts are available some days also they have pizzas, fish and chips, and a pie night.
There is a pub about 2 miles away on the A35.
There is nothing not to like about this site.

Monkton Wyld is a clean, and efficiently run site which is quiet enough as a site.
However, there is a big BUT. If you are looking for a quiet location for your visit for a short break during the main holiday months of July/August we could not recommend.
The location appears very tranquil until you realise that it is bordered by two 'B' class and one major 'A' trunk road with heavy traffic driving past for most of the night!
So if you are looking for that tranquil place, away from traffic noise, it is not the best location.
Other than that, it is good for accessing many tourist attractions on the Jurassic coast.

This site disappointed us - for the number of pitches, plus a rally field there were two shower blocks, one of which had 3 toilets and 2 showers, which were very dated. Most pitches were occupied by families with at least 4 people and on the day we arrived the toilet block near us was blocked - so even worse.
The staff in reception were really friendly and helpful but the site lacked any atmosphere - just felt flat and soulless - strangely enough a previous reviewer felt the same.
The dog walk area was odd - a beautiful small woods but couldn't let him off the lead so felt pointless.
For a camping and caravanning site this felt like a commercial 'chain' campsite - very odd. In truth we left cutting our losses and stayed at The relaxing and wonderful Hook Farm in Lyme Regis Instead. Just not right for us.
